On the Kindle Fire there is a pre-installed gallery app. I haven't used it yet, but I found some info directly from Amazon explaining the how-tos:



Gallery

To start using the Gallery app, tap the Gallery app icon from the Apps screen, either from the Cloud or Device tab.
Once you've transferred content to your Kindle Fire (http://www.amazon.com/gp/help/customer/display.html?nodeId=200729530#usbtransfer) or downloaded content using the Amazon Silk web browser (http://www.amazon.com/gp/help/customer/display.html?nodeId=200729650#images), the content will be saved in your Gallery.

Viewing pictures

From the Gallery home screen, tap Pictures to view your images. Tap the Slideshow icon to start a slideshow of all pictures on your Kindle Fire. Use the magnifying glass icons or pinch to zoom in and out of an image.
Tap the Menu icon at the bottom of the screen for more options. Tap the Share icon to send an e-mail with the picture using the Amazon Email app (http://www.amazon.com/gp/help/customer/display.html?nodeId=200789350). Tap the More icon to crop or rotate your image, and to view image details. Tap the Delete icon to delete the image.

Viewing downloads

From the Gallery home screen, tap Downloads to view images and videos you downloaded using the Amazon Silk web browser. Use the scroll bar to scroll through your files.
Tap the Menu icon at the bottom of the screen for more options. Tap the Share icon to send an e-mail with your downloaded file using the Amazon Email app (http://www.amazon.com/gp/help/customer/display.html?nodeId=200789350). Tap the More icon to crop or rotate an image, or view more details. Tap the Delete icon to delete the file.
